Summary : The Mechanical Quality Technologist is responsible for performing in-process and final inspections of sub-assemblies and finished products in accordance with established standards and specifications. This role applies ISO-9001 quality requirements, documents inspection results, and works closely with production, engineering, and quality teams to ensure product compliance. Key Responsibilities : Perform in-process and final inspections to verify products meet engineering, quality, and customer requirements Apply ISO-9001 standards by following Inspection Plans, Inspection Specification Procedures, and Process Specifications Identify special inspection requirements and ensure assemblies meet all defined criteria Conduct specialized inspections as required within the manufacturing process Analyze in-process materials and finished goods for quality and conformance Monitor assembly processes to ensure adherence to specifications, protocols, and standard work methods Interpret test results (including rundown and resistance reports) and validate compliance with specifications and control limits Accurately document inspection results, defects, and nonconformances within the quality system Ensure inspection and test equipment is properly calibrated, validated, and safely maintained Maintain a strong understanding of products, quality processes, and Quality Policy requirements Collaborate regularly with production, engineering, and QA teams Train and support Assistant Mechanical Quality Technologists as needed Qualifications : High school diploma or equivalent One or more years’ assembly inspection experience and three or more years’ experience working in a Manufacturing Environment.
